Technical field
The utility model relates to door and window production and processing technical field, specifically a kind of vibration screening device of plastic grain.
Background technology
In the production of door and window, need to use plastic plate, different plastic plate is stirred by different plastic raw materials, melt after stirring, reshaping, plastic raw materials needs to pulverize rear mixing, some particle of mixed raw material is larger, be unfavorable for next step fusing, so need the plastic grain by particle strengthens to sieve out aborning, traditional method uses vibratory sieve, but it is limited for the sieving capacity of vibrating sieve for plastic granules, and vibratory sieve can not fast smoothly by the backflow of particles of backlog demand in reducing mechanism, cause production efficiency slower.
Utility model content
For solving the problem, the utility model discloses a kind of vibration screening device of plastic grain, comprise: screening case, screen pack, observation panel, feed pipe, vibrating motor, base, spring supporting post, recovery tube, discharge nozzle, described screen pack level is fixed in screening case, described observation panel is arranged on screening case upper surface rear portion, it is anterior that described feed pipe is arranged on screening case upper surface, and feed pipe top is rubber bellows, described vibrating motor is sieving bottom case by support installing, described spring supporting post is four, upper end is connected to screening case corner, lower end is fixed on base, described discharge nozzle is arranged on bottom screening case, described recovery tube is arranged on screening case rear end.
Described spring supporting post is made up of spring, tubule, extra heavy pipe, latch, and described spring is fixed on tubule, and described tubule is inserted in extra heavy pipe, and tubule, extra heavy pipe all has corresponding spacing hole, and described latch is fixed in spacing hole.
Described spring supporting post is divided into two kinds, and the length at rear portion is less than front portion.
The utility model is a kind of vibration screening device of plastic grain, raw material enters screening case from charging aperture, fall on screen pack, vibrating motor drives the vibration of screening case, spring supporting post can ensure that screening case fully vibrates, charging aperture upper end is rubber bellows, and charging aperture will not drive connected pipe vibration; Spring supporting post rear portion length is less than front portion, and screening case tilts, and the plastics that particle is little pass filter screen, discharge from discharging opening, and the plastics that particle is large drop down onto screening case end, discharge, enter pulverizer and pulverize from recovery tube; Screening upper box part has observation panel, changes the length of front springs support column according to screening effect, changes the gradient of screening case, regulates screening effect.
The utility model has the advantages such as structure is simple, screening effect good, easy to use.
